How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 77018?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 77018 Studio Apartments | $1,578 | $1,043 | $2,123 |
| 77018 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,732 | $480 | $5,209 |
| 77018 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,031 | $850 | $7,941 |
| 77018 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,157 | $1,226 | $4,025 |
| 77018 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,093 | $2,068 | $2,118 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 77018 ZIP Code
What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in the 77018 ZIP Code?
As of today, August 27, 2026, there are currently 297 available 77018 apartments priced from $480 to $11,022, with an average monthly rent of $2,022.
How much are Studio apartments in 77018?
There are currently 19 Studio Apartments in 77018 with rent ranges from $1,043 to $2,123 with an average price of $1,578.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 77018 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 77018 ranges from $480 to $5,209 with an average monthly rent of $1,732.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 77018 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 77018 range from $850 to $7,941.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,031.
How expensive are 77018 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 45 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 77018 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,226 to $4,025 - averaging $2,157 for the location.
